Howard, Crooms, Jenkins, Buoy, Buntin, Pendleton, and Bybee Best Fields on Saturday at I-44 Speedway!
OKLAHOMA CITY, Okla. (April 25, 2026) - Garyn Howard, Blake Crooms, Clayton Jenkins, Bryton Buoy, Lloyd Buntin, Zachary Pendleton, and Colton Bybee bested their respective fields on Saturday at I-44 Speedway in Dacus Heating & Air Super 7 Weekly Series action.
A field of 75 entries filled the pits on a unfavorable forecasted Saturday night featuring 11-Victory Motorsports Non-Wing, 11-Mr Electric A-Class, 17-Wright Water Restricted, 6-Tulsa Shootout Junior Sprints, 10-B&R Services Turf Tire, 8-JAM Powersports 600cc Modifieds, and 12-IMCO USRA Tuners.
Racing resumes on Saturday, May 2 with $1,000 to win A-Class plus the fourth points race of 2026.

44 Speedway is under the direction of Terry Mattox Promotions. I-44 Speedway races every Saturday night featuring the Dacus Heating & Air Super 7 Weekly Series for micro sprints, junior sprints, 600cc modifieds, and front wheel driver four cylinders.
